November 22 ~ 1: Budget 2: Drayton Youth Centre: In 1995, a number of people had a vision to start a

Youth Centre in Drayton. A Board was established and it met regularly. Plans were discussed and plans were implemented. The new Centre officially opened in September of 1999 in the basement of the Drayton Pentecostal Tabernacle. As more and more youth attended the Centre, it became clear that the place was too small. After months of hard work, with many dedicated volunteers, and prayer, the present location was found, renovated, and opened on April 6, 2001. The support of the community, which includes businesses, churches, ladies' groups, and individuals has been tremendous and is very much appreciated.

Chaplaincy and Care Ministry - Please join us in honoring our chaplains on Chaplain Sunday, Nov. 22. The CRCNA chaplains are specially trained men and women who serve in hospitals, hospices, counseling agencies, long term care facilities, correctional facilities, community service agencies, Veterans Affairs centers, the military, and the workplace. They touch hundreds of lives every day with the presence and the love of Christ. Our network of chaplains stretches literally from the prison to the Pentagon. Whether in a nursing home or on a battlefield, our chaplains have served with courage and distinction over the course of the last century.
